Abstract: The present invention relates to a one-step process useful in the chemical analysis for atomising electrolyte solutions or fluids with electric conductivity, and a multielement direct analysis method of the components of such fluids, which is also operable in a monitoring mode. In this analysis method, the one-step atomisation of the fluid is followed by optical and/or mass spectroscopy determination of the sample components. The atomisation process is characterised by generating an electric discharge of 1000 to 5000 V/cm on the surface of said electrolyte between the fluid as cathode and the anode positioned in the gas atmosphere above the said fluid.
